How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mission Hills?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mission Hills Studio Apartments | $1,301 | $725 | $2,192 |
| Mission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,831 | $750 | $4,004 |
| Mission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,274 | $845 | $5,471 |
| Mission Hills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,625 | $1,995 | $7,806 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Mission Hills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Mission Hills with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Mission Hills is at Forest Court Apartment Homes listed at $845.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Mission Hills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Mission Hills is $2,274.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Mission Hills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Mission Hills is a 1,454 square feet unit starting from $2,879 at The Locale.
What is the average size for Mission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Mission Hills is currently 949 sq ft.
